We coated solely the fundamentals of constructing a live video streaming expertise for iOS and Android using React Native. If you wish to create a live streaming app that will catch the eye create live streaming app, you should deal with a singular and engaging design. It’s not a secret that design influences how folks really feel about your utility. So, you need to rent a staff that can ship professional UI/UX design providers from the very first steps of your application.
Declare Permissions For Android: Mainapplicationkt
Thus, as a substitute https://www.globalcloudteam.com/ of requiring e mail and password, the applying verifies the person’s identification via one of the preferred social networks. This one-click registration reduces the variety of incomplete sign-ups and increases the app’s variety of users. For a sender, an application should allow custom-made commenting options, thus giving the person greater management over the comments posted to the stream. The most necessary prerequisite for a successful design is the broad expertise and futuristic imaginative and prescient of your UX/UI design group. The staff will create a mix of your brand image and aggressive design elements to provide a supreme appear and feel.
Is Video Streaming Software Improvement Totally Different From Video Streaming Platform Development?
ManyCam is a virtual digital camera and stay streaming software with a broad variety of use instances. It integrates with most main stay streaming platforms and has a quantity of features that let you customise your streams. You can easily change between multiple video sources, scribble on a digital whiteboard and even stream in 4K.
Specialists Customise Your Video Streaming App
- In order to increase the impression and attain of the live occasion, numerous reside streaming app intentionally current users with the choice to protect the content material as an archived video.
- Otherwise, you’d need to choose a service like Cloudflare, Akamai, or Microsoft Azure CDN.
- This method ensures a swift supply of a useful product whereas minimizing prototype costs.
Max Wilbert is a passionate author, stay streaming practitioner, and has strong experience within the video streaming trade. Free and open source software program for video recording and stay streaming. Poor efficiency, similar to high latency and low-resolution videos, can negatively impression the consumer experience. Instead, make sure you choose a platform with a reliable and safe infrastructure with a global footprint to attenuate latency.
Interesting Live Streaming Market Statistics
Open AndroidManifest.xml and add the following in the manifest tag above the application part to set digital camera, microphone, and Bluetooth permissions. In abstract, when people launch the app for the primary time, they will get the above message prompts to allow or disallow the usage of their digicam and microphone on iOS. Find the Objective C file AppDelegate.mm and add the next code snippet to make the video SDK out there for iOS. Regularly conduct load testing to simulate excessive site visitors eventualities and establish potential weaknesses in your infrastructure. This helps you prepare for real-world utilization and ensures that your app can handle peak loads. Use tools like application efficiency monitoring (APM) to identify bottlenecks and optimise useful resource utilization.
Add Keys And Values For Android Permissions: Androidmanifestxml
Finally, we’ll distil the finder points revolving across the technical details, including establishing mobile apps through APIs and SDKs from skilled video streaming platforms. And we’ll also tell you about how Dacast’s skilled technicians can get you up and operating, fast. A reside streaming application permits content creators to seize, broadcast, document, and distribute videos and occasions in real time.
Why Should I Build A Reside Streaming Software Or Add Streaming Capabilities To My App?
That’s how customers will have the flexibility to log in using their account on Facebook or Twitter. Now we’re clear with the steps you want to take to create a live streaming app. It’s time to proceed to MVP features and spotlight what options your new streaming app or web site should embody. Our staff applies a mix of WebRTC (web real-time communications) and RTMP (real-time messaging protocol) to add a live video streaming capability into the application. WebRTC is a dependable broadcasting expertise that permits knowledge trade between browsers, whereas RTMP allows high-definition broadcasting. As you can see from the desk, the approximate price of building an MVP for a stay video streaming app at Orangesoft is round $72K.
Tech Stack For Stay Streaming App Development
Live stream viewers can simply download an app to their cellular gadgets or stream content, and many popular social media apps supply stay streaming capabilities. Remarkably, numerous stay streaming platforms have garnered immense recognition on a world scale. Live streaming is a live video broadcast of sure occasions available for viewing in real-time by way of the Internet and is certainly one of the greatest and most effective ways to report from the scene. All broadcasts are hosted by streamers who use different applications divided into a number of types. There are so many various reside streaming apps floating around the preferred app shops.
The underlying livestreaming expertise uses a Selective Forwarding Unit (SFU) to replicate livestreams over totally different servers worldwide. DEV Community — A constructive and inclusive social community for software builders. With this, we efficiently built the React Interactive Live Streaming app with video SDK.
You will need to pay moreover for CDN, however every little thing might be paid off. Every yr this type of media grows in popularity and takes increasingly more viewers attention. According to analysts, the worldwide stay streaming market will reach $223.ninety eight billion by 2028. This growth is as a outcome of of the reality that increasingly more investments are coming into this industry and extra companies are creating their very own reside streaming functions. Following the best practices of stay streaming app growth, our group applies a combination of WebRTC (web real-time communications) and RTMP.